文摘BACKGROUND Duodenal biopsies are commonly obtained during esophagogastroduodenoscopy(EGD)but are very often histopathologically normal.Therefore,a more strategic method for evaluating the duodenal mucosa and avoiding unnecessary biopsies is needed.AIM To examine the clinical utility of narrow band imaging(NBI)for evaluating duodenal villous morphology.METHODS We performed a prospective cohort study of adult patients at Mayo Clinic Rochester from 2013-2014 who were referred for EGD with duodenal biopsies.A staff endoscopist scored,in real-time,the NBI-based appearance of duodenal villi into one of three categories(normal,partial villous atrophy,or complete villous atrophy),captured≥2 representative duodenal NBI images,and obtained mucosal biopsies therein.Images were then scored by an advanced endoscopist and gastroenterology fellow,and biopsies(gold standard)by a pathologist,in a masked fashion using the same three-category classification.Performing endoscopist,advanced endoscopist,and fellow NBI scores were compared to histopathology to calculate performance characteristics[sensitivity,specificity,positive and negative,negative predictive value(NPV),and accuracy].Inter-rater agreement was assessed with Cohen’s kappa.RESULTS 112 patients were included.The most common referring indications were dyspepsia(47%),nausea(23%),and suspected celiac disease(14%).Duodenal histopathology scores were:84%normal,11%partial atrophy,and 5%complete atrophy.Performing endoscopist NBI scores were 79%normal,14%partial atrophy,and 6%complete atrophy compared to 91%,5%,and 4%and 70%,24%,and 6%for advanced endoscopist and fellow,respectively.NBI performed favorably for all raters,with a notably high(92%-100%)NPV.NBI score agreement was best between performing endoscopist and fellow(κ=0.65).CONCLUSION NBI facilitates accurate,non-invasive evaluation of duodenal villi.Its high NPV renders it especially useful for foregoing biopsies of histopathologically normal duodenal mucosa.

文摘Crohn’s disease with involvement of the esophagus,stomach and duodenum has a prevalence of 0.5%to 4%in symptomatic adult patients,but some studies have shown that these results may be underestimated,since upper gastrointestinal endoscopy is not performed routinely in the initial evaluation of the disease in adult patients,as it is in the pediatric population.In general,involvement of the upper gastrointestinal tract in Crohn’s disease occurs concomitantly with involvement of the lower gastrointestinal tract.The diagnosis depends on clinical,endoscopic,histological and radiological evaluation.The presence of aphthoid ulcers,longitudinal ulcers,bamboo-joint-like appearance,stenoses and fistulas are endoscopic findings suggestive of the disease,and it is important to exclude the presence of Helicobacter pylori infection.The primary histological findings,which facilitate the diagnosis,are the presence of a chronic inflammatory process with a predominance of lymphoplasmacytic cells and active focal gastritis.The presence of epithelioid granuloma,although less frequent,is highly suggestive of the disease in the absence of chronic granulomatous disease.Treatment should include the use of proton pump inhibitors associated with corticosteroids,immunomodulators and biological therapy according to the severity of the disease.

文摘Caspase-8(CASP8) is one key regulator of apoptosis of T lymphocytes and is encoded by the CASP8 gene. It has been reported that the six-nucleotide deletion polymorphism(-652 6 N del) of the CASP8 gene had effect on some cancer risk. Few studies explored the association between CASP8 gene polymorphism and digestive tract cancer risk.To evaluate the association between the CASP8-652 6 N del polymorphism and the risk of digestive tract cancer, we conducted this meta-analysis. We found that CASP8-652 6 N del polymorphism was associated with a significantly reduced risk of digestive tract cancer in the co-dominant model(del/del vs. ins/ins: OR= 0.82, 95%CI= 0.72-0.95;del/ins vs. ins/ins: OR = 0.92,95%CI = 0.87-0.97;dominant model(del/ins + del/del vs. ins/ins: OR = 0.91,95%CI =0.87-0.96, recessive model: del/del vs. del/ins + ins/ins: OR = 0.85, 95%CI = 0.75-0.97). In the stratified analysis by cancer types, we found that all genetic models had protective effect on gastric cancer. Similar results were observed for colorectal cancer under heterozygote comparison and dominant model, but not under homozygote comparison or recessive model. In addition, a significantly decreased risk was found on esophageal cancer for most genetic models,except heterozygote comparison. When stratified by ethnicity and source of control, an evidently decreased risk was identified in the Asian populations and population-based studies. In conclusion, there exists an association between the CASP8-652 6 N del polymorphism and reduced digestive cancer risk, especially among Asians and populationbased studies.
文摘Food restriction is a strategy to improve the productive efficiency of some aquatic organisms.It is expected with the implementation of food restriction programs to first reduce the feed consumption by the cultivated species and consequently reduce the waste load in the water.In addition,there is a lower employment of labor during periods of food restriction.However,the efficiency of the feed restriction and the compensatory gain of weight by the organisms cultivated will depend on the adaptation and the characteristics of the species in question.Several methodologies have tested forms of food restriction applied to fish farming.Some of them are addressed in this review,as well as results and comparisons made with several authors on the subject in question.The purpose of this paper was to describe the main reasons for using food restriction,its implications on fish organism and to compare results from previous studies.

文摘The exposure to plastic debris and associated pollutants for wildlife is of urgent concern,but little attention has been paid on the transfer of plastic additives from plastic debris to organisms.In the present study,the leaching of incorporated flame retardants (FRs),including polybrominated diphenyl ethers (PBDEs),alternative brominated FRs (AFRs),and phosphate flame retardants (PFRs),from different sizes of recycled acrylonitrile-butadiene-styrene (ABS) polymer were investigated in avian digestive fluids.The impact of co-ingested sediment on the leaching of additive-derived FRs in digestive fluids was also explored.In the recycled ABS,BDE 209 (715 μg/g) and 1,2-bis(2,4,6-tribromophenoxy) ethane (BTBPE,1766 μg/g) had the highest concentrations among all target FRs.The leaching proportions of FRs were higher in finer sizes of ABS.The leaching proportions of FRs from recycled ABS increased with elevated logKow of FRs.In the tests with coexisted ABS and sediment,hexato deca-BDEs,BTBPE,and decabromodiphenyl ethane (DBDPE) migrated from ABS to sediment,which resulted in the less bioaccessible fractions of these FRs in gut fluids.More lipophilic chemicals tended to be adsorbed by sediment from ABS.The results suggest the migration of additive-derived FRs from plastics to other indigestible materials in digestive fluids.The findings in this study provide insights into the transfer of additive-derived FRs from plastics to birds,and indicate the significant contribution of FR-incorporated plastics to bioaccumulation of highly lipophilic FRs.

文摘With the digestive endoscopic tunnel technique(DETT),many diseases that previously would have been treated by surgery are now endoscopically curable by establishing a submucosal tunnel between the mucosa and muscularis propria(MP).Through the tunnel,endoscopic diagnosis or treatment is performed for lesions in the mucosa,in the MP,and even outside the gastrointestinal(GI)tract.At present,the tunnel technique application range covers the following:(1)Treatment of lesions originating from the mucosal layer,e.g.,endoscopic submucosal tunnel dissection for oesophageal large or circular early-stage cancer or precancerosis;(2)treatment of lesions from the MP layer,per-oral endoscopic myotomy,submucosal tunnelling endoscopic resection,etc.;and(3)diagnosis and treatment of lesions outside the GI tract,such as resection of lymph nodes and benign tumour excision in the mediastinum or abdominal cavity.With the increasing number of DETTs performed worldwide,endoscopic tunnel therapeutics,which is based on DETT,has been gradually developed and optimized.However,there is not yet an expert consensus on DETT to regulate its indications,contraindications,surgical procedure,and postoperative treatment.The International DETT Alliance signed up this consensus to standardize the procedures of DETT.In this consensus,we describe the definition,mechanism,and significance of DETT,prevention of infection and concepts of DETTassociated complications,methods to establish a submucosal tunnel,and application of DETT for lesions in the mucosa,in the MP and outside the GI tract(indications and contraindications,procedures,pre-and postoperative treatments,effectiveness,complications and treatments,and a comparison between DETT and other operations).

文摘The Na^+/Ca^2+exchanger(NCX)protein family is a part of the cation/Ca^2+exchanger superfamily and participates in the regulation of cellular Ca^2+homeostasis.NCX1,the most important subtype in the NCX family,is expressed widely in various organs and tissues in mammals and plays an especially important role in the physiological and pathological processes of nerves and the cardiovascular system.In the past few years,the function of NCX1 in the digestive system has received increasing attention;NCX1 not only participates in the healing process of gastric ulcer and gastric mucosal injury but also mediates the development of digestive cancer,acute pancreatitis,and intestinal absorption.This review aims to explore the roles of NCX1 in digestive system physiology and pathophysiology in order to guide clinical treatments.
